When you think of workwear you usually envision stiff collared shirts, blazers, drab colors, and clothes that you typically wouldn’t want wear outside of your 9-to-5. But finding pieces that express your personality, are wearable on weekends and don’t break the office dress code isn’t impossible – they are just a scroll away. Continue reading for some inspiration, useful shopping links, and how we view “the new business casual”.

Adding pieces like the Claribel Belted Top is an easy way to brighten a workwear outfit. This tropical floral print (which is all the rage this season) features a flattering waist tie and high round neckline. An asymmetrical slip skirt compliments its free-flowing silhouette making it the outfit to cure Monday blues.

The Rhodes Pop Over Shirt, a French Connection essential, is upgraded this Spring with baby blue and white double stripes. The oversized, relaxed fit makes it a comfortable shirt that’s still office-appropriate thanks to the pointed collar and crisp, cotton material. Style with a pair of slim fit pants and a classic trench for a modern take on a timeless look.

Complete your weekday wardrobe with an updated version of the staple white button down. Floral embroidery and a frilled grandpa collar on the Ezra shirt add a feminine feel to this classic piece which can be styled many ways, from a pair of tailored trousers to a denim midi skirt for a more casual office setting.
